Practical Designer Notes for Small Business Owners
Before using the Watercolor Turtle and Rainbow in a real project, it’s wise to test it on actual packaging mockups. This will help you see how it looks in scale and whether it complements the overall design. Check how it appears in black and white, as this can affect its visibility and impact.
Preview it on small labels to ensure it remains legible and doesn’t get lost in the details. Test it against your brand colors to make sure it harmonizes well. Compare it with competitor packaging to ensure it stands out in the marketplace.
Key Considerations for Commercial Use
Make sure the Watercolor Turtle and Rainbow comes with a commercial license if you plan to use it for client work, business branding, or physical product sales. Verify the file formats available—such as SVG or PNG—and inspect their editability and transparency. These factors can influence how easily the design can be adapted for different uses.
Finally, review how it looks with different font styles. Pair it with serif, sans serif, script, or handwritten fonts to see which combinations work best for your brand. This will help ensure that the overall design remains cohesive and professional.
